🚜 Farmers, take note!

If your insured crops are damaged or lost due to things like bad weather or other covered perils, don’t forget to contact your Agricultural Insurance Officer. A Notice of Loss must be submitted within 5 days of noticing the issue. Reporting early helps make sure your claim gets processed smoothly!

🔥Fire Safety During Harvest

Harvest time is the most important part of the agricultural calendar. While these dry conditions are the most favourable to bring in the grain crop, conditions are extreme - so doing it safely and avoiding a wildfire is a priority.

What can farmers do to be fire safe when combining and baling in these extremely dry conditions?

🚜 ensure that machinery is maintained and clean of harvest debris build up
🧯 carry a fire extinguisher with each piece of equipment
💧 have a source of water at the ready (e.g., spray truck/tank full of water)
🚜 have a set of discs connected to a tractor at the ready to create a fire break

These practices can help contain a fire within the field and avoid it spreading to the tree line and beyond.

TO REPORT A WILDFIRE, CALL 911.

🟤 Grow The Herd Pilot Program 🟤

A sustainable Canadian Agricultural Partnership designed to grow the beef cow population in our province.

The Grow the Herd Pilot Program is designed to grow the beef cow population in the province and increase the number of beef cattle processed in PEI.
